Mighty Therm Volume Water Heaters

Page 23

If the gas valve is found to be defective, replace

it by following these instructions.

1.

Turn off electrical power to the heater.

2.

Turn off the main gas supply at the manual gas
cock outside the heater jacket or at the meter.

3.

Remove the front access door on the heater.

4.

Disconnect the service union in the gas line, and
unscrew the main gas pipe from the gas valve
(see Figure 30).

5.

Remove the two screws that fastens the anti-
rotation bracket on the left side of the gas valve
(see Figure 30), and the three screws attached to
heater.

6.

Remove the pilot gas tube and copper
thermocouple shield, if present, from the gas
valve.

Caution

Label all wires prior to disconnection. Wiring errors
can cause improper and dangerous operation.

7.

Tag and remove all wires from the gas valve
terminals.

8.

Pull the burner tray out of the heater (see
Figure 30).

9.

Screw the new gas valve onto the manifold pipe.
Make sure the arrow on the bottom of the gas
valve that indicates the direction of gas flow is in
the proper direction. Also make sure the brass
fitting is on the right side.

10.

Connect the pilot gas tube to the pilot assembly
and thermocouple to the gas valve.

NOTE: Due to sharp edges on the metal burners, wear
protective gloves for the next steps.

11.

Hold the gas burner or pilot burner firmly, and
push it away from the manifold until it is clear of
the orifice. Slide the burner to be replaced out of
the burner tray (see Figure 31).

12. To replace the gas burner, insert the burner into

the slot at the rear of the burner tray, line it up
with the proper orifice and snap it into position.

13.

To replace the pilot burner, install the pilot
assembly on the new pilot burner and install it in
the burner tray.

14.

Slide the burner tray back into the heater and
fasten it with two screws.

15.

Install the anti-rotation bracket to the inner panel
and fasten with two screws (see Figure 30), and
the three screws to heater.

16.

Connect the service union in the gas line, and
screw the main gas pipe to the gas valve (see
Figure 30).

17.

Turn on gas valve following the lighting
instructions found on the inside of the heater.

18.

Turn on the main gas supply at the manual gas
cock or the meter.

19.

Check the system for leaks using a soap solution.

Caution

Since some leak test solutions (including soap and
water) may cause corrosion or stress cracking, rinse
the piping with water after testing.

20.

Reconnect the electrical wires to the gas valve in
accordance with the wiring diagram found on the
inside of the heater.

21.

Install the front access door on the heater.

22.

Turn all electrical power to the heater on.
